What is I'm Smelling What You're Cooking?


1.

To understand the concept that someone is trying to convey.

A phrase to use when you want to let the other person know that you understand what he/she is talking about and they can stop trying to explain it.

Dude: So, the carburetor and the pistons...

Me: I'm smelling what you're cooking
